颅骨全层高压电烧伤并脑挫裂伤及颅内感染的治疗 被引量:11

Treatment of full-thickness electric burn of skull combinedwith cerebral contusion and intracranial infection

摘要 1病历摘要 患者男,28岁。在约8m高处作业时双手不慎与10 kV高压电线接触,致身体多处烧伤并坠落,着地后昏迷约10 min。被送至当地医院治疗,CT检查示双侧枕部硬脑膜外血肿、左侧枕叶挫裂伤,给予抗休克、左上肢切开减张等治疗。伤后Sd转入我院。 This article reports che treatment of a patientffering from full-thickness electric burn of skull combined with cerebral contusion and intracranial infection to provide experience in treating such patients. Based on deLailed analysis on patient's condition and CT results, several operations of' surgery and anti-infection treatment were performed on the patient. Thewounds healed 6 weeks after injury. The skull def'ect was repaired with three-dimensionally reconstructed titanium mesh of computer-aided design two years after wound healing. The treatment of full-thickness electric hurn of skull combined with cere- bral contusion was quite difficult. The timing and mode of operation were very important. Perioperative prevention and treatment of intracranial infection were essential to save the life of the patient. In che event of intracranial infection, effective systemic use of antibiotic.s, cerebrospinal fluid drainage, intrathecal injection of drugs, and the application of other comprehensive measures could ensure the success of treatment.
